Recomend a 22 rifle...
Hi guys I want to build a nice 22 rifles. I have been browsing the local gun store for a used 10/22 but I haven’t found one that suit my price. I want to spend around 150, and want to build it up later. Nothing crazy like buying a Pacer and dropping a V10 on it. Something that I can do at home like the 10/22, maybe get a match barrel, scope, new stock etc. etc. What other 22 rifle are out there that you would recommend?

A 10/22 shouldn't be hard to find at a decent price. If you're looking to mod a 22 rifle, I'd recommend the 10/22. You get so many options for modifying it & there are many sources to choose from. I'd be concerned with another rifle that you simply won't have the options available, even though you have the gun. Just look at various websites for 22 target barrels, stocks, triggers, etc. It is overwhelmingly geared toward the Ruger 10/22.
By the way, yes I own one and am extremely pleased with the gun. I've had it since I was a kid and I'm over 40 now and it still shoots great & reliably. My daughters are now learning on it. |
